  • Empowering Housewives: Understanding Their Divorce Rights

    When we think of divorce, the image of a working couple going their separate ways often comes to mind However, there is a significant portion of divorces where one partner has chosen to stay at home and take care of the household and children These individuals, often referred to as housewives, play a crucial role in the family dynamic but may face unique challenges when it comes to divorce In this article, we will explore the rights of housewives when it comes to divorce and how they can navigate this challenging process.

    Housewives have long been undervalued and underappreciated for the work they do in the home While their contributions may not be as easily quantifiable as a paycheck, the emotional, physical, and mental labor they put into maintaining a household and caring for their family is invaluable However, when it comes to divorce, many housewives find themselves in a vulnerable position due to their financial dependence on their spouse.

    One of the primary concerns for housewives facing divorce is their financial security Without a steady income of their own, they may worry about how they will support themselves and their children post-divorce In many cases, housewives may have sacrificed their careers or education to support their partner’s ambitions, leaving them at a significant disadvantage when it comes to entering the workforce This lack of financial independence can make the divorce process even more daunting for housewives.

    However, it is essential for housewives to understand that they do have rights when it comes to divorce In most jurisdictions, marital assets are divided equitably between both parties, regardless of who earned the income during the marriage housewife divorce rights. This means that housewives are entitled to a fair share of the marital property, including the family home, savings accounts, retirement funds, and other assets acquired during the marriage Additionally, housewives may be entitled to spousal support or alimony to help them transition to a single-income household.

    When it comes to determining spousal support, courts will consider several factors, including the length of the marriage, the income disparity between spouses, the standard of living during the marriage, and the contributions each spouse made to the household Housewives who gave up their careers to support their spouse’s career or raise their children may be entitled to a more significant share of the marital assets or a higher amount of spousal support to compensate for their sacrifices.

    In addition to financial support, housewives also have rights when it comes to child custody and visitation Courts will always prioritize the best interests of the child when making custody decisions, taking into account factors such as the child’s relationship with each parent, the stability of each parent’s home environment, and the child’s preferences Housewives have just as much right to seek custody of their children as their working counterparts, and the courts will consider their role as the primary caregiver when making custody determinations.

    Housewives should also be aware of their rights to legal representation during the divorce process While hiring a lawyer may seem daunting or expensive, having a knowledgeable attorney on their side can significantly impact the outcome of their divorce settlement A lawyer can help housewives navigate the complexities of divorce law, advocate for their rights in court, and ensure that they receive a fair and equitable settlement.

    In conclusion, housewives facing divorce have rights and protections under the law that can help them secure their financial future and protect their children’s best interests It is crucial for housewives to educate themselves about their rights and seek legal counsel to ensure that they receive a fair divorce settlement By empowering themselves with knowledge and support, housewives can navigate the divorce process with confidence and emerge from it stronger and more independent than ever before.

  • All You Need To Know About Servo Drives

    servo drives are essential components of modern automation systems, providing precise control over the speed, position, and torque of electric motors. These devices play a crucial role in a wide range of applications, from robotics and CNC machines to packaging equipment and automotive systems. In this article, we will explore the key features, benefits, and applications of servo drives, as well as important considerations when selecting and using these devices.

    A servo drive, also known as a servo amplifier or servo controller, is a specialized electronic device that works in conjunction with a servo motor to control its behavior. Unlike standard motors, servo motors require a feedback mechanism to accurately control their position, speed, and torque. This feedback is typically provided by a rotary encoder or resolver, which continuously monitors the motor’s actual position and velocity, allowing the servo drive to make real-time adjustments to achieve the desired performance.

    One of the key advantages of servo drives is their ability to provide precise and rapid control over the motion of a motor. This level of control is essential in applications where high accuracy and responsiveness are required, such as in robotics, manufacturing, and automated systems. servo drives can deliver smooth acceleration and deceleration, accurate positioning, and high torque at low speeds, making them ideal for demanding applications that require precise motion control.

    Another important feature of servo drives is their flexibility and programmability. Most modern servo drives are equipped with advanced control algorithms and communication interfaces that allow them to be easily integrated into complex automation systems. With the right programming, servo drives can perform a wide range of motion control tasks, such as trajectory planning, synchronized motion, and electronic gearing. This flexibility enables manufacturers to customize the behavior of their machines to meet specific performance requirements.

    servo drives offer several benefits over traditional motor control methods, such as variable frequency drives (VFDs) and stepper motors. One of the main advantages is their ability to deliver high torque at low speeds, making them suitable for applications that require precise positioning and high acceleration capabilities. Servo drives can also operate at high speeds without sacrificing torque, allowing them to achieve fast response times and high dynamic performance.

    In addition to their performance advantages, servo drives are also known for their energy efficiency and reliability. By precisely controlling the motor’s speed and torque, servo drives can minimize energy consumption and reduce heat generation, leading to lower operating costs and extended motor life. Furthermore, servo drives are designed to withstand harsh industrial environments and operate reliably under demanding conditions, ensuring uninterrupted operation in critical applications.

    Servo drives are used in a wide variety of industries and applications, where precise motion control is essential. In the manufacturing sector, servo drives are commonly used in CNC machines, robotic arms, and conveyor systems to achieve high accuracy and productivity. In the automotive industry, servo drives are employed in assembly lines, welding robots, and material handling equipment to optimize production processes and ensure consistent quality.

    Other common applications of servo drives include packaging machinery, printing equipment, semiconductor manufacturing, and medical devices. In these industries, servo drives play a crucial role in enabling automated processes, improving product quality, and increasing operational efficiency. Whether it’s precision cutting in a laser engraving machine or fast pick-and-place operations in a semiconductor wafer handler, servo drives are indispensable for achieving optimal performance and reliability.

    When selecting a servo drive for a specific application, there are several important factors to consider, such as the motor type, power rating, control interface, and feedback system. It’s crucial to choose a servo drive that is compatible with the motor and feedback device, as well as capable of meeting the performance requirements of the application. Additionally, proper tuning and configuration of the servo drive are essential to achieve optimal motion control performance and system stability.

  • Exploring The Impressive Polytetrafluoroethylene Thermal Conductivity

    When it comes to materials that are known for their thermal properties, polytetrafluoroethylene stands out as a remarkable choice Polytetrafluoroethylene, commonly known by its brand name Teflon, is a synthetic fluoropolymer that boasts a wide range of impressive characteristics In particular, its thermal conductivity is a key feature that makes it highly sought after in various industries and applications.

    Thermal conductivity is the property that defines a material’s ability to conduct heat Essentially, it measures how well a material can transfer heat through it In simple terms, a material with high thermal conductivity will transfer heat more efficiently compared to a material with low thermal conductivity Polytetrafluoroethylene falls into the category of low thermal conductivity materials, which makes it an excellent choice for specific applications where heat resistance is crucial.

    One of the main reasons why polytetrafluoroethylene is valued for its low thermal conductivity is its unique molecular structure The polymer chain of polytetrafluoroethylene consists of carbon atoms bonded to fluorine atoms, resulting in a highly stable and non-reactive structure This molecular arrangement contributes to the material’s exceptional resistance to heat, chemicals, and environmental factors, making it an ideal choice for applications in harsh conditions.

    In terms of thermal conductivity, polytetrafluoroethylene has a relatively low value compared to metals and other materials commonly used for heat transfer purposes The thermal conductivity of polytetrafluoroethylene typically ranges from 0.25 to 0.3 W/mK, which is significantly lower than metals like copper or aluminum While this might seem like a downside, the low thermal conductivity of polytetrafluoroethylene is actually a desirable characteristic for many specific applications.

    One of the primary benefits of polytetrafluoroethylene’s low thermal conductivity is its insulating properties Due to its ability to resist heat transfer, polytetrafluoroethylene is often used as an insulating material in various electronic components, wire coatings, and gaskets polytetrafluoroethylene thermal conductivity. In these applications, the low thermal conductivity of polytetrafluoroethylene helps prevent heat loss or transfer, ensuring the efficient operation of electrical systems and devices.

    Another advantage of polytetrafluoroethylene’s low thermal conductivity is its suitability for high-temperature applications Despite its low thermal conductivity, polytetrafluoroethylene can withstand temperatures ranging from -200°C to 260°C, making it a versatile material for use in extreme temperature environments Its ability to resist heat transfer helps maintain stable temperatures in equipment and components, enhancing their performance and longevity.

    In addition to its thermal insulation properties, polytetrafluoroethylene’s low thermal conductivity also makes it an excellent choice for applications that require low friction and non-stick properties Teflon, a popular trade name for polytetrafluoroethylene, is widely recognized for its non-stick coating used in cookware and industrial applications The low thermal conductivity of polytetrafluoroethylene helps reduce friction and prevent heat build-up, contributing to its exceptional non-stick characteristics.

    Despite its numerous advantages, polytetrafluoroethylene’s low thermal conductivity may pose challenges in certain applications where heat transfer is desired In such cases, additional measures such as incorporating heat sinks or thermal conductive fillers may be necessary to enhance the material’s heat transfer capabilities By combining polytetrafluoroethylene with other materials, engineers and manufacturers can tailor its thermal properties to suit specific application requirements.

  • The Evolution Of Cremation Machines: A Look Into The Modern Technology Of Death

    cremation machines, also known as cremators or crematory retorts, have come a long way since their inception in the late 19th century. These machines are designed to reduce human remains to ashes through the process of high-temperature combustion. While cremation has been practiced for thousands of years in various cultures around the world, the technology behind modern cremation machines has significantly evolved to become more efficient, environmentally friendly, and technologically advanced.

    One of the key components of a cremation machine is the retort, which is the chamber where the body is placed for cremation. Early cremation machines were simple brick or stone structures that relied on wood or coal fuel to reach the high temperatures needed for cremation. However, these early machines were inefficient and often produced a high amount of smoke and pollution. As technology advanced, modern cremation machines now use cleaner and more efficient fuel sources such as natural gas or propane. Some cremation machines have even incorporated advanced filtration systems to reduce emissions and minimize environmental impact.

    In addition to fuel source improvements, modern cremation machines have also evolved in terms of design and construction. cremation machines are now typically made of stainless steel or other durable materials that can withstand high temperatures and repetitive use. Advanced insulation materials are also used to retain heat and improve energy efficiency. Many modern cremation machines are equipped with computerized control systems that allow for precise temperature regulation and monitoring throughout the cremation process. This not only ensures a more efficient and thorough cremation, but also enhances the overall safety and reliability of the machine.

    Furthermore, advancements in technology have enabled cremation machines to become more user-friendly and versatile. Some modern cremation machines are equipped with hydraulic lifts or other mechanisms to easily load and unload the body, reducing the physical strain on operators. Additionally, cremation machines can now accommodate a wide range of body sizes and shapes, making them suitable for a diverse range of individuals. Some machines even have the capability to perform multiple cremations simultaneously, increasing efficiency and reducing wait times for cremation services.

    Another significant advancement in cremation machine technology is the introduction of emission control systems. Traditional cremation processes release pollutants such as mercury, dioxins, and carbon monoxide into the atmosphere. However, modern cremation machines are equipped with sophisticated emission control systems that capture and neutralize these harmful substances. This not only helps to protect the environment and public health, but also ensures compliance with strict air quality regulations.

    Despite these advancements, cremation machines continue to face challenges and controversies. Some critics argue that cremation machines are energy-intensive and contribute to greenhouse gas emissions. However, proponents of cremation argue that it is a more environmentally friendly alternative to traditional burial practices, which require the use of embalming chemicals, caskets, and land for burial sites. Additionally, cremation allows for the recycling of metals such as gold and silver from dental fillings and joint replacements, which can be repurposed for other uses.

  • The Future Of Freeze-Drying: Liquid Lyophilization

    Freeze-drying, also known as lyophilization, is a commonly used method for preserving perishable materials. This process involves freezing a substance and then removing the ice (sublimation) under vacuum, creating a stable product with a longer shelf life. However, traditional lyophilization methods have their limitations, including long processing times and potential damage to delicate materials.

    Enter liquid lyophilization, a cutting-edge technique that promises faster and more efficient drying of liquid solutions. This innovative approach could revolutionize the field of freeze-drying, making it easier and more cost-effective to produce a wide range of products, from pharmaceuticals to food and cosmetics.

    liquid lyophilization works by first freezing the liquid solution in a thin layer, typically less than 1 mm thick. This is in contrast to traditional freeze-drying, which involves freezing the entire solution in bulk. The thin layer of frozen liquid in liquid lyophilization allows for more efficient heat transfer and shorter drying times.

    Once frozen, the liquid layer is then subjected to vacuum conditions, causing the ice to sublimate directly into a gas without passing through the liquid phase. This direct sublimation process results in the removal of water from the frozen solution, leaving behind a dry product.

    One of the major advantages of liquid lyophilization is its ability to preserve the structure and integrity of delicate materials. Traditional freeze-drying methods can cause damage to sensitive compounds due to the formation of ice crystals and prolonged exposure to heat. liquid lyophilization minimizes these risks by drying the material quickly and efficiently, preserving its original properties.

    Another key benefit of liquid lyophilization is its potential for scalability. This method can be easily adapted for large-scale production, making it ideal for industries that require high volumes of dried products. The faster processing times of liquid lyophilization also translate to cost savings and increased productivity for manufacturers.

    liquid lyophilization has a wide range of applications across various industries. In the pharmaceutical sector, this innovative drying method can be used to produce stable drug formulations that have a longer shelf life. By preserving the integrity of active ingredients, liquid lyophilization ensures that pharmaceutical products remain effective over time.

    In the food industry, liquid lyophilization offers a way to create lightweight, shelf-stable food products that retain their nutritional value and flavor. This method can also be used to produce instant coffee powders, freeze-dried fruits, and other convenience foods that appeal to consumers looking for quick and easy meal solutions.

    The cosmetics industry can also benefit from liquid lyophilization by creating powdered formulations of skincare products and makeup. By removing water from these products, manufacturers can prolong their shelf life and reduce the risk of microbial contamination. Liquid lyophilization also allows for the creation of customized beauty products with unique textures and properties.

  • The Role Of Pharma Lab Equipment In Research And Development

    Pharmaceutical research and development is crucial for advancing medicine and improving the quality of healthcare worldwide. In order to conduct successful drug research, pharmaceutical companies heavily rely on specialized equipment in their laboratories. These tools are essential for drug discovery, formulation, testing, and production. From analyzing chemical compounds to testing drug effectiveness, pharma lab equipment plays a critical role in the pharmaceutical industry.

    One of the key functions of pharma lab equipment is drug discovery. To develop new medicines, researchers rely on high-tech instruments that can analyze and identify chemical compounds. Spectrophotometers, chromatographs, and mass spectrometers are commonly used to characterize substances and determine their properties. These instruments help scientists understand the chemical structure of compounds and their potential therapeutic effects.

    Once potential drug candidates are identified, researchers move on to drug formulation. Equipment such as mixers, granulators, and tablet presses are used to manufacture pharmaceutical products in a controlled environment. These machines ensure that drugs are produced consistently and meet regulatory standards. Formulation equipment plays a crucial role in scaling up production while maintaining product quality and efficacy.

    In addition to drug discovery and formulation, pharma lab equipment is also essential for drug testing. In vitro and in vivo studies are conducted to assess the safety and efficacy of new drugs. Microscopes, centrifuges, and incubators are used to perform various biological assays and experiments. These tools help researchers understand how drugs interact with biological systems and evaluate their potential side effects.

    Moreover, pharma lab equipment is crucial for quality control and assurance. As pharmaceutical products need to meet strict regulations and quality standards, laboratories must use specialized instruments to monitor the purity, potency, and safety of drugs. HPLC systems, DNA sequencers, and thermal analyzers are commonly employed to ensure that drugs are consistently produced and meet required specifications.

    Another important aspect of pharma lab equipment is process validation. Before drugs can be manufactured on a large scale, pharmaceutical companies must validate their production processes to ensure that they are robust and reliable. Equipment such as autoclaves, lyophilizers, and sterilizers are used to validate the sterilization and packaging processes of drugs. This ensures that drugs are free from contaminants and can be safely administered to patients.

    Furthermore, pharma lab equipment plays a crucial role in research and development for personalized medicine. With advances in genomics and proteomics, researchers are now able to tailor treatments to individual patients based on their genetic makeup. DNA sequencers, PCR machines, and mass spectrometers are used to analyze genetic information and identify biomarkers that can be used to develop personalized therapies. This personalized approach to medicine is revolutionizing healthcare and improving patient outcomes.

  • The Ultimate Guide To Car Tent Roof Tops

    When it comes to camping and outdoor adventures, having a reliable shelter to protect you from the elements is crucial. That’s where car tent roof tops come in. These innovative and convenient devices allow you to transform your car into a cozy and comfortable sleeping area in just minutes. In this article, we will discuss everything you need to know about car tent roof tops.

    What is a car tent roof top?

    A car tent roof top, also known as a rooftop tent, is a tent that is mounted onto the roof of a car. These tents are designed to provide a safe and elevated sleeping area for outdoor enthusiasts. car tent roof tops come in various sizes and styles, with most models featuring a built-in mattress, ladder for easy access, and sturdy construction to withstand the elements.

    Benefits of using a car tent roof top

    There are several advantages to using a car tent roof top for your outdoor adventures. Firstly, car tent roof tops provide an elevated sleeping platform that keeps you off the ground, away from insects, critters, and damp ground. This can significantly improve your comfort and safety while camping. Secondly, car tent roof tops are easy to set up and take down, saving you time and effort compared to traditional camping tents. Additionally, car tent roof tops are versatile and can be used on various terrains, making them ideal for road trips, off-grid camping, and outdoor events.

    Types of car tent roof tops

    There are several types of car tent roof tops available on the market, each with its own unique features and benefits. Hardshell roof top tents are made of durable materials such as fiberglass or aluminum, providing excellent protection from the elements and added security. Softshell roof top tents are more lightweight and flexible, making them easier to install and pack away. Pop-up roof top tents are another popular option, featuring a simple and quick setup process. Whichever type you choose, make sure to consider factors such as size, weight capacity, and ease of use when selecting a car tent roof top.

    How to choose the right car tent roof top

    When choosing a car tent roof top, there are several factors to consider to ensure that you select the right one for your needs. Firstly, consider the size of the tent and make sure it fits your car’s roof rack. Additionally, check the weight capacity of the tent to ensure it can support you and any gear you may bring. It’s also important to consider the material and construction of the tent to ensure it can withstand harsh weather conditions. Finally, think about additional features such as windows, ventilation, and accessories to enhance your camping experience.

    Tips for using a car tent roof top

    Once you have selected and installed your car tent roof top, there are a few tips to keep in mind to make the most of your outdoor adventures. Firstly, practice setting up and taking down the tent before your trip to ensure you are familiar with the process. Additionally, make sure to secure the tent properly to prevent any accidents while driving. It’s also a good idea to pack essential camping gear such as sleeping bags, pillows, and lanterns to make your stay more comfortable. Lastly, be mindful of the weather and terrain conditions to ensure a safe and enjoyable camping experience.

  • Unlocking The Future Of Research: A Guide To Biochemical Assay Development

    biochemical assay development plays a crucial role in the research process, allowing scientists to analyze and measure various biological processes and interactions at a molecular level. These assays provide valuable insights into the function and behavior of biological molecules, helping researchers understand diseases, develop new treatments, and unlock the secrets of life itself. In this article, we will explore the importance of biochemical assay development, the challenges involved, and some of the key steps in designing and optimizing these essential tools for scientific discovery.

    Biochemical assays are laboratory techniques used to measure the presence or activity of a specific molecule in a biological sample. These molecules can include proteins, enzymes, nucleic acids, and other biomolecules that play important roles in cellular processes. By developing assays that can accurately detect and quantify these molecules, scientists can better understand how they function, interact with each other, and respond to various stimuli. This knowledge is essential for advancing our understanding of biology and developing new treatments for a wide range of diseases.

    One of the main challenges in biochemical assay development is ensuring that the assay is sensitive, specific, and reliable. Sensitivity refers to the ability of the assay to detect small amounts of the target molecule, while specificity refers to its ability to accurately measure only the target molecule and not other molecules in the sample. Reliability is crucial for reproducibility, ensuring that the results obtained from the assay are consistent and can be trusted by other researchers. Achieving these qualities requires careful optimization of the assay conditions, including the choice of detection method, reagents, and protocols.

    There are several steps involved in designing and optimizing a biochemical assay. The first step is to define the purpose of the assay and choose the appropriate detection method based on the properties of the target molecule. For example, if the target molecule is an enzyme, an enzyme activity assay may be used to measure its catalytic activity. Next, researchers must select the reagents and controls needed for the assay, ensuring that they are of high quality and do not interfere with the detection of the target molecule. Optimization of the assay conditions, such as pH, temperature, and reaction time, is then carried out to maximize sensitivity and specificity.

    Once the assay has been optimized, validation studies are conducted to ensure that it performs reliably and consistently. This involves testing the assay on a large number of samples to assess its accuracy, precision, and linearity. Validation studies are crucial for demonstrating that the assay is fit for purpose and can be used with confidence in research and clinical settings. Finally, the assay is ready for use in experiments to investigate biological processes, test hypotheses, and discover new insights.

    biochemical assay development is not only essential for basic research but also has important applications in drug discovery and development. Assays are used to screen large libraries of compounds for potential drug candidates, identify new drug targets, and optimize the efficacy and safety of existing drugs. By developing assays that can accurately measure the activity of enzymes, receptors, and other drug targets, scientists can accelerate the drug discovery process and bring new treatments to market faster.
